🌟 Lvgl:现代嵌入式GUI的新标准Lvgl(LittlevGL)是一种开源的图形用户界面库,专为嵌入式系统而设计,具有轻量级、高效率和可定制性的特点。它支持各种显示设备和输入设备,提供丰富的图形元素和动画效果,使开发人员能够快速构建现代化的用户界面。🌐 Lvgl的优势Lvgl不仅仅是界面的展示工具,它还通过优化内存使用和渲染速...
1-GUI-Guider的使用和介绍 安装过程不在说明,应该没有难度,这里不在介绍。 首先打开软件,界面如下所示: 在这里插入图片描述 点击创建新项目,然后选择LVGL版本,当前GUI-Guider支持7.10和8.3两种版本,具体使用哪一个自行选择,本项目使用的是8.3版本。 在这里插入图片描述 然后点击下一步: 在这里插入图片描述 选择上图...
LVGL 是目前主流的嵌入式GUI框架,可以通过它很便捷的开发应用层的交互页面,通过深入学习底层原理能够更好的理解LCD屏幕和FrameBuffer和驱动之间的关系,可以为我们后续优化LVGL显示性能打下基础。 发布于 2023-07-28 19:53・IP 属地广东 内容所属专栏 巫山老妖 微信公众号【巫山老妖】同号,不定期更新。 订阅专栏 ...
Gui Guider(恩智浦)是PC端GUI设计工具,可以通过拖放控件方式设计LVGL GUI页面,加速GUI设计。设计完成后可在PC上仿真运行,确认设计完毕后生成python脚本,再整合入模组中。完成开发。 Gui Guider下载地址。 本文将介绍如何使用GUI Guider辅助进行Quecpython LVGL开发。 GUI Guider的主要特征 支持Windows 10和Ubuntu 20.04。
嵌入式系统中常用的GUI库:emWin LVGL(主流) TouchGFX(可以直接帮我们生成图形界面,不需要手敲代码) QT(通过图形界面生成ui,在市场的占有率非常高) LVGL简介 LVGL(Light and Versatile Graphics Library)是一个轻量、多功能的开源图形库。 特点: 支持多种输入设备(触摸屏、键盘、鼠标、编码器) ...
这款工具采用直观的拖放控件图形化设计方式,让用户能够轻松地开发LVGL GUI界面。更便捷的是,它还能在PC端仿真生成代码,并直接移植到嵌入式设备上运行。试用了一下GUI Guider,界面和演示效果确实挺不错的。不过,GUI Builder的更新速度似乎跟不上LVGL的版本进展。目前LVGL已经更新到了V9,而NXP仅支持到V8,这对...
GUI Guider是一个专门针对LVGL开发了一个上位机GUI设计工具,可以通过拖放控件的方式设计LVGL GUI页面,加速GUI的设计。设计完成的UI页面可以在PC上仿真运行,确认设计完毕之后可以生成C代码,再整合到MCU项目中。
Qt for MCUs是一个完整的图形框架和工具包,包含在微控制器上设置、开发和部署GUI所需要的一切。您可以在裸机或实时操作系统上运行应用程序。 Qt for MCUs带有三样开发工具,包括一个配备了完善的代码编辑器、版本控制等功能的IDE(Qt Creator);以Qt QML语言编写的帮助从头开始或基于咸亨UI空间快速设计和构建应用程序...
首先安装GUI guider,本次使用的是1.5.1版本GUI guider。打开软件,选择创建新工程。 选择V8.3.2版本的LVGL。 选择模拟的。 选择一个模板,这里选了空模板。 设置工程路径,名称。设置lcd屏幕大小和颜色位数,要和你实际需要移植的lcd屏对应。 下面就是新建的工程了,后面就饿可以设置面板控制的。
在可穿戴产品领域,LVGL已成为一款备受推崇的GUI库。LVGL是一款轻量级的、开源的图形库,专为嵌入式GUI设计。它能帮助开发者为嵌入式设备打造美观的用户界面。借助LVGL模拟器,开发者能在电脑上轻松编辑和显示界面,待测试完成后,再将其移植至嵌入式设备中,从而大大提高项目开发效率。LVGL的特点 LVGL提供了丰富且强大...